| 6 | Leginon runs under both the Linux and Microsoft Windows Operating systems. However, the |
||
| 7 | current php-mrctool can not be installed on Windows which means mrc images can not be viewed |
||
| 8 | on the web. See the section on Possible Computer Set-up Configurations for details. |
||
| 9 | |||
| 10 | |||
| 11 | The many components for the Leginon system are divided into packages and need to be |
||
| 12 | installed separately. It has been integrated with several third party software packages that |
||
| 13 | are necessary for its operation. The installation documentation will describe how to set-up |
||
| 14 | Leginon and give hints as to how to install and set-up the necessary third-party software. |
||
| 15 | This documentation is not intended to support the additional, but necessary third-party |
||
| 16 | software. |
||
| 17 | |||
| 18 | |||
| 19 | There has been interest in installing Leginon under Mac OS X. While this is possible in |
||
| 20 | theory, we have not been successful in installing a fully functional system. The two main |
||
| 21 | problems are (1) compilation of php-mrctool from the pre-installed php and (2) wxPython on Mac |
||
| 22 | is unable to hide bitmap objects which makes Leginon graphical user interface difficult to |
||
| 23 | use. |
